copyright Downloader Alternatives: Acquire Your Apps Safely
If you've been exploring the app store and considering alternatives, it's vital to prioritize official methods. While APKPure itself has had its issues, there are numerous other avenues to download your desired applications without experiencing security vulnerabilities. Quite a few reputable app stores, including the Google Play Store (for Android devices) and alternative app markets with rigorous checking processes, offer a vast selection of apps. Furthermore, manufacturer app stores from device makers (like Samsung, Xiaomi, or Huawei) provide access to apps specifically optimized for their devices. Remember that obtaining apps from untrusted sources can leave your device to malware, so always opt for verified sources and check user feedback before installing anything.

Obtaining APKs: Significant Risks Revealed
While downloading copyright files directly from beyond the Google Play Store can seem appealing, it also introduces serious security risks. Altered APKs, often advertised as "mod APKs" offering premium features for free, are a large source of malware. Furthermore, seemingly legitimate platforms like APKPure, while offering a vast selection of applications, have historically been associated with infected files. Relying on such sources bypasses Google’s security checks and leaves your device vulnerable to viruses, invasive programs, and personal data breaches. It's essential to understand these likely implications before downloading and installing applications from third-party sources. Always prioritizing your device’s security by sticking to official app sources whenever feasible.
